Post by Gorhoops » November 29th, 2021, 3:26 pm

You all have realized that we were not allowed to "slow walk" our defensive subs on the field at the end of the half to stop the field goal, a number of referee's have said as much. That rule was put in to allow the defense to substitute to match up to offensive substitutions, but in that FG situation, the expectation is that everyone knows what the offense is doing, so waiting for the defense to get the subs in is not allowed in that situation.

Our coaches sucked Saturday, but that is not one of the reasons why. The rules did not allow for us to slow walk subs into the game at that point,.
